Latest Patents

Hillard's latest patents include an "Automated Fault Diagnosis Device and Method" and an "Optical Speed Sensing System." The Automated Fault Diagnosis Device is designed to sense signals from machines and determine periodic events based on these signals. It incorporates analog to digital processing components, a transform algorithm, memory, and an analysis algorithm to provide users with critical information regarding machine performance. In the event of a suspected fault, the device alerts the user, allowing for timely repairs or further analysis.

The Optical Speed Sensing System is another groundbreaking invention that determines the rotational speed of an object without requiring reflective singularities. This system utilizes a light source to illuminate a target area, and an optical system processes the reflected light to calculate the object's speed. The automated signal processing results in a clear RPM solution displayed for the operator.
